Edo miso; Tokyo-style miso
A traditional miso produced in the Tokyo area since the Edo period, typically low-salt and made with rice koji.

江戸味噌は、江戸時代から東京で作られている甘口味噌です。
Edo miso is a sweet miso that has been made in Tokyo since the Edo period.

Compound of 江戸 (Edo, the former name of Tokyo) and 味噌 (miso). The name reflects its origin in the Edo region.
